Workforce planning, a vital component of strategic human capital management. It's about aligning an organization’s human capital — its people — with its business plan in order to achieve its objectives, targets and goals on a mission based plan. This, in other words, means ensuring that an organization currently has and will continue to have the right people with the right skills in the right job at the right time at the right place for the right purpose performing their roles, tasks assignments optimally, efficiently, productively and effectively.

The Process involves the following:

Define your organization’s strategic direction

Scan the Internal and External Environments (Internal for Potential, and External for Lateral Hire with Potential to contribute and grow)

What is the Model (Structure) in which the Current Workforce is functioning

Assess future workforce needs and project. You should be able to forecast Future Workforce Needs and Anticipate Growth Oriented Project to ensure future workforce supply

You will have to Identify gaps and develop gap-closing strategies (in terms to skills and numbers).

Implement gap-closing strategies. Evaluate the effectiveness of gap-closing strategies and revise strategies as needed.

Manpower planning is an HR function linked with strategic planning. It is based on a number of inputs, the primary ones being: (i) existing Organization Structure, (ii) Business Growth Plan, (iii) percentage of Revenue allocated to Manpower, and (iv) Your compensation norms, etc.

Mr. Raman and Bhaita have given you the right suggestions. In addition to these, you should also review the performance appraisals from the last year. It would be beneficial to interact with the managers of various functions to determine the specific skill sets required for optimal results. Consider the new projects at hand and the growth strategies for the company in new areas and domains.

Has a SWOT analysis been conducted for the company based on the previous year's performance, taking into account external and internal factors? If not, it may be a good time to conduct a SWOT analysis with the assistance of all department heads. Have the processes been clearly defined? By performing these tasks, you will be able to identify the skill set requirements at various levels and determine the training needs to enhance the competence of the current workforce.
